What Is Holding Time?

A “holding time” is the elapsed amount of time from the point of collection to the moment of preparation or analysis.If samples are analyzed beyond an analytical holding time, the data will be qualified on the analytical report and may not be usable for compliance.

What is maximum holding time?

Maximum holding time means the greatest number of minutes, hours, or days that a sample may be kept between sampling and the beginning of analysis and still be considered a valid sample for compliance testing.

What is the hold time for pH?

15 minutes
Methods 9040 and 9045 for pH both say that samples should be analyzed as soon as possible. 40 CFR 136 Table II defines the maximum holding time for Hydrogen ion (pH) as 15 minutes.

What is holding time in microbiology?

Holding time and temperature can have a significant impact on the density of microbiological indicators at the time of sample analysis (4, 5, 7). Recommendations for E. coli holding times range from 8 h (2, 3, 9) to 24 h (8), and holding temperatures below 10°C are generally considered acceptable (2, 3, 8, 9).

What is the holding time for TSS?

7 days
A very common pollutant on many NPDES stormwater permits, TSS (total suspended solids), has a holding time of 7 days. Chemical oxygen demand, another common pollutant parameter has a holding time of 28 days.

What is the holding time if the water sample is not preserved?

Holding times are generally very short – 8 hours for source water compliance samples, 30 hours for drinking water samples, 48 hours for coliphage samples.

How do you preserve a sample?

Preservation methods are limited to pH control, chemical addition, amber or opaque bottles, filtration, refrigeration, and freezing. To minimize the potential for volatilization or biodegradation between sampling and analysis, keep the sample as cool as possible without freezing.

Why are holding times important?

Required holding times ensure that the sample is analyzed for the requested parameter prior to any bio-degradation, oxidation, precipitation, sorption, volatilization, and other physical and chemical processes that may occur that can affect the integrity of the sample.

How do you preserve a wastewater sample?

Preservation is accomplished by refrigerating or by adding nitric acid. Dissolved gases (oxygen, carbon dioxide, hydrogen sulfide), pH, and temperature can change within minutes after collection. There are no practical methods of preserving these. Analyses for them should be performed at the collection site.

How do you collect a water sample for microbiological analysis?

Hold the closed bottle near its base and plunge it below the surface. Remove the top and turn the bottle until its neck points slightly upward and mouth is directed toward the current. If there is no current, create one by pushing the bottle forward away from the hand. Replace cap before pulling the sample out.

How do you preserve cod samples?

Samples are iced or refrigerated and kept at 4°±2°C from time of collection until analysis. Preserved samples must be analyzed within 28 days of collection.

How do you preserve water samples for heavy metal analysis?

HNO3 acid is required to preserve the water samples to minimize metal cation precipitation and adsorption onto the sample.
